Non-Volatile Memory (EEPROM) Commands
The non-volatile memory in the XLP 6000 can store a program string thus
providing the user with the option of computer-free operation. The pump can be
configured to run stored programs using the U<30> command. See "Pump
Configuration Commands" earlier in this chapter.
s <n>
Load Program String into Non-Volatile Memory
The [s] command is placed at the beginning of a program string to load the
string into the non-volatile memory. The syntax for this command is:
[s<n>]
where <n> = 0..14
Up to 15 program strings (numbered 0 through 14) can be loaded into the
non-volatile memory. Each string can use up to 128 characters. For example,
[IA3000OA0R] requires 10 bytes.
Example Program String: [s8ZS1gIA3000OA0GR]
Command Segment
Description
s8
Loads string into program 8 of non-volatile memory (Address
switch position 8)
Z
Initializes pump
S1
Sets plunger speed
g
Marks start of loop
I
Turns valve to input position
A3000
Moves plunger to position 3000
O
Turns valve to output position
A0
Moves plunger to position 0
G
Endlessly repeats loop
R
Executes command string
